Review of The Town that Dreaded Sundown (2014) by Anthony K — 14 Jan 2015
Amazingly well-made and has the makings of becoming a cult classic like it's predecessor. This isn't a remake of the original film, but almost a sort of sequel to it. The camerawork and atmosphere were very potent.
It didn't hold back at all in it's gruesome killing scenes and the acting wasn't lame or overdone. A true horror gem. Go see it!
